Well I'll be damnedquote:Nearly thirty years ago, Frank Miller introduced us to an older, far more wizened Batman late in his career. But the newest Dark Knight project, Dark Knight Returns: The Last Crusade, will take us back to over ten years before this classic work, when Batman was still actively fighting crime with his previous Robin, Jason Todd, at his side, revealing the previously untold story of how Jason met his end in Frank Miller’s Dark Knight universe and featuring the first appearance of Miller’s Joker since his death in The Dark Knight Returns. http://www.dccomics.com/blog/2015/11/13/dark-knight-returns-the-last-crusade-john-romita-jr-discusses-his-new-dark-knight
